Understanding the Importance of Lattice Maker Plugin for SketchUp
Before we dive into the world of plugins, it’s essential to grasp the significance of lattices in 3D design. Lattices are grid-like structures that consist of intersecting lines or bars. They can be used in a variety of ways to enhance your 3D models. For instance, lattice structures can add complexity and visual interest to architectural designs, provide structural support to intricate shapes, or simply serve as decorative elements.
Lattices are widely used in architecture, interior design, furniture design, and many other fields. They can be both functional and aesthetically pleasing, making them a valuable addition to your SketchUp toolbox.

Lattice Maker: Unleash Your Creative Potential
The Lattice Maker plugin is a must-have for anyone working with SketchUp, especially if you’re passionate about lattice structures. Here are some of the key features and benefits that make Lattice Maker stand out:
- Effortless Lattice Creation
Lattice Maker simplifies the process of creating lattices in SketchUp. With just a few clicks, you can generate intricate lattice patterns that would be time-consuming to create manually. This efficient workflow allows you to focus on the creative aspects of your design. - Customizable Designs
Lattice Maker provides a wide range of customization options. You can adjust parameters such as the spacing between lattice elements, the thickness of the bars, and the overall size of the lattice. This flexibility ensures that your lattice designs perfectly match your project’s requirements. - Real-Time Editing
One of the standout features of Lattice Maker is its real-time editing capabilities. You can make changes to your lattice design on the fly, and the plugin will automatically update the model, saving you valuable time and effort. - Versatility
Lattice Maker isn’t limited to a single type of lattice. It supports various lattice styles, including square, triangular, and hexagonal patterns. This versatility allows you to explore different design possibilities and adapt lattices to various architectural styles. - Export Options
Once you’ve created your lattice design, Lattice Maker offers export options, allowing you to save your lattice as a separate component for future use. This feature is particularly useful if you want to use the same lattice design across multiple projects.
